This sequel to hatchet and the river imagines that yearold brian robeson wasnt rescued the summer after he survived a plane crash and had to survive the winter in the canadian wilderness. It is the third novel in the hatchet series, but second in terms of chronology as an alternate ending sequel to hatchet.
